Top Reasons Nursing Schools Do Not Accept Qualified Applicants
This List Sponsored by Medical Home Newson Fri, 08/06/2010
- Lack of nursing faculty: 61.4%
- Insufficient clinical teaching sites 60.8%
- Limited classroom space 47.5%
- Budget cuts 32.2%
- Insufficient preceptors 31%
Notes: Respondents may list more than one factor. Adapted from AACN 2009 Survey of Baccalaureate and Higher Degree Programs- http://www.aacn.nche.edu/Media/pdf/TurnedAway.pdf.
Source: "Fully-utilized Nursing Workforce Essential for Health Care Quality", Medical Home News, April 2010
